Overview
Bitcoin's price fell below $70,000 following a surge in oil prices driven by escalating conflict between Iran and Israel, alongside the Federal Reserve's decision to hold interest rates steady.

Why now
- Recent escalation in Iran-Israel conflict has sharply increased oil prices, pressuring markets.
- Federal Reserve's March meeting confirmed no interest rate cuts, tightening financial conditions.
- Bitcoin's price volatility and sentiment shifts reflect immediate macro and geopolitical uncertainties.
Why it matters
- Geopolitical tensions and Fed policy directly impact Bitcoin's price and market sentiment.
- Investor behavior shows resilience despite volatility, affecting market dynamics.
- Options market defensiveness signals institutional caution about near-term downside risks.
